Being figured out – sized up – is a mixed blessing. For example, the other night after ordering Indian food, the restaurant called back to ask if I’d forgotten to order the Sag Paneer extra spicy like I normally do. How considerate! Yet how annoying that I’m so predictable. That’s sort of how I felt when I finally flipped through the new West Elm catalog – that somebody had figured me out. It was like they reverse engineered my carefully cultivated aesthetic and then presented it to the world as beautiful, mass produced components priced as low as $2.99. (Seriously). And let’s face it, they’ve put everything together far better than I ever could. From the dark paint colors on the walls to the clean lines and the orange chair (I love orange!), it was as if the good people at West Elm put together their latest collection with me in mind (or at least my demo), so their catalog will undoubtedly lure me into their new Lincoln Park showroom. While buying from a big retail chain will never replace the pleasures of browsing a quaint little shop or haggling with a flea market dealer, as the new West Elm catalog illustrates so well, the results can be just as pretty.
